168.5 Kilograms of Trash on Kelapa Island Cleaned

The community work at RW 01, Kelapa Island Urban Village, Seribu Utara District, Seribu Islands cleaned 168.5 kilograms of garbage.

Head of Kelapa Island Urban Village, Muslim said this community work is part of a collective effort to raise public awareness of the importance of environmental cleanliness.

"Today's activity was participated by 60 people from urban village civil servants, cadres, PJLP, PPSU, Karang Taruna, RT/RW caretakers, and residents," he said, Wednesday (10/1).

Muslim explained that the community work was carried out after the Pancasila Sanctity Day ceremony, starting from clearing weeds, pruning trees, to collecting garbage.

He added that this community work could also improve the relationship between residents and the government.

"This is very important because the Seribu Islands are a leading tourist destination in Jakarta," he added.

Meanwhile, Head of RW 01, Kelapa Island Urban Village Head, Sapriudin admitted he was enthusiastic to participate the community work.

"This community work is actually run routinely. Hopefully this effort will increase the number of tourist visit to the island," he hoped.
